Full-Time Maintenance person

2/22/2022

8 Comments

 
The Catholic Community of Corpus Christi  is seeking a full-time maintenance person - 35 hour per week.

Job Summary:  Provide janitorial services and assist in the maintenance of grounds of the Parish - Rectory-Casa Emmaus-Warehouse.  If interested please submit a resume to corpuschristifinance@gmail.com or bring it to the parish office.  For more information contact the parish office.

    Our employees will provide an example to the community by maintaining good standing in the Catholic Church through adherence to the laws of the Church and through practice of the Faith by living a sacramental, moral Catholic life including regular Mass attendance.  
     
    Because all Diocesan employees represent the Roman Catholic Church, they are expected to conduct themselves according to the goals and missions of the Church in performing their work.  This entails actively supporting the philosophy and goals of the Church; participating in Church activities including attending services and encouraging others to do so.
     
    NOTE:  The Diocese of El Paso adheres to the Charter for the Protection of Children and Young People of the United States Conference of Catholic Bishops and the Safeguard the Children, VIRTUS, and related programs of the Diocese.  As such, prospective employees are required to complete VIRTUS training, fingerprinting and a background check before employment.
